What is Capitol Care?
Capitol Care, Inc. operates as a specialized provider of behavioral health services, distinguished by its commitment to empowering individuals with developmental disabilities. By integrating interdisciplinary care teams, the company facilitates personalized treatment journeys that prioritize individual choice and adaptive support mechanisms. Their market position is defined by a focus on culturally competent care and the promotion of community integration, effectively bridging the gap between clinical necessity and personal wellness. As a preferred provider, Capitol Care leverages its unique service model to address complex behavioral health requirements, ensuring that clients remain central to their own therapeutic outcomes.
How much funding has Capitol Care raised?
Capitol Care has raised a total of $350K across 1 funding round:
Debt
$350K
Debt (2020): $350K with participation from PPP
